2 ENGLISH
SPECIFICATIONS
Model: DHP486
Drilling capacities Masonry 16 mm
Steel 13 mm
Wood Auger bit: 50 mm
Self-feed bit: 76 mm
Hole saw: 152 mm
Fastening capacities Wood screw 10 mm x 90 mm
Machine screw M6
No load speed (RPM) High (2) 0 - 2,100 min
-1
Low (1) 0 - 550 min
-1
Blows per minute High (2) 0 - 31,500 min
-1
Low (1) 0 - 8,250 min
-1
Overall length 178 mm
Rated voltage D.C. 18 V
Net weight 2.3 - 2.7 kg
Due to our continuing program of research and development, the specications herein are subject to change without notice.
Specications may di󰀨er from country to country.
The weight may di󰀨er depending on the attachment(s), including the battery cartridge. The lightest and heavi-
est combination, according to EPTA-Procedure 01/2014, are shown in the table.
Applicable battery cartridge and charger
Battery cartridge BL1815N / BL1820B / BL1830B / BL1840B / BL1850B / BL1860B
Charger DC18RC / DC18RD / DC18RE / DC18SD / DC18SE / DC18SF /
DC18SH
Some of the battery cartridges and chargers listed above may not be available depending on your region of residence.
WARNING: Only use the battery cartridges and chargers listed above. Use of any other battery cartridges
and chargers may cause injury and/or re.

Intended use
The tool is intended for impact drilling in brick, brickwork
and masonry. It is also suitable for screw driving and
drilling without impact in wood, metal, ceramic and
plastic.
Noise
The typical A-weighted noise level determined accord-
ing to EN62841-2-1:
Sound pressure level (L
pA
) : 84 dB(A)
Sound power level (L
WA
) : 95 dB (A)
Uncertainty (K) : 3 dB(A)
NOTE:
The declared noise emission value(s) has been
measured in accordance with a standard test method
and may be used for comparing one tool with another.
NOTE:
The declared noise emission value(s) may
also be used in a preliminary assessment of exposure.
WARNING: Wear ear protection.
WARNING: The noise emission during actual
use of the power tool can di󰀨er from the declared
value(s) depending on the ways in which the
tool is used especially what kind of workpiece is
processed.
WARNING: Be sure to identify safety mea-
sures to protect the operator that are based on an
estimation of exposure in the actual conditions of
use (taking account of all parts of the operating
cycle such as the times when the tool is switched
o󰀨 and when it is running idle in addition to the
trigger time).
